Background
- Scope and content:
-
This collection contains serial issues, correspondence, pamphlets, reports, flyers, serial issues, and other printed matter relating to various peace movements and activist causes throughout the United States, such as disarmament, draft opposition, nuclear energy opposition, foreign policy reform, and opposition to wars in Central America and Southeast Asia. This collection was curated by Eleanor Kleinhans, who is often referred to as "Ronnie" throughout the materials present.
